HP to Integrate Cloud into Preferred Partner Program

An image of Kevin Matthews, HP UK and Ireland channel manager for enterprise storage, servers and networking (WEB HOST INDUSTRY REVIEW) — HP ( www.hp.com ) said it is planning to introduce a formal cloud computing component into its Preferred Partner Program starting its next fiscal year to address the continuing trend of resellers developing their own cloud propositions, according to a report by CRN . Kevin Matthews, HP UK and Ireland channel manager for enterprise storage, servers and networking, said that many of HP’s partners were turning away from the traditional reselling relationship with the company. Matthews said that this will continue in new formal benefits that will be introduced with PPP 2012 this November.

MS Says PBX Is Dead as Lync Unifies Communications

MS Says PBX Is Dead as Lync Unifies Communications Microsoft on Wednesday released Lync, the “next generation” of unified communications for businesses. The platform integrates instant messaging, presence, audio, video, web conferencing, and voice along with Microsoft Office , SharePoint and Exchange. Gurdeep Singh Pall, corporate vice president of the company’s Lync and speech group, said Lync will help IT departments “enhance or eliminate their traditional PBX systems” by unifying all modes of modern business communications and offering “a more collaborative, ‘in person’ experience with features like HD video, conference recording, and social features like status updates and activity feeds.” …

Web Host GalaxyVisions Deploys Green Practices at Data Center

Inside GalaxyVisions’ green data center in Brooklyn (WEB HOST INDUSTRY REVIEW) — Web hosting provider GalaxyVisions ( www.galaxyvisions.com ) announced on Wednesday it is using ecologically-friendly practices at its Brooklyn-based data center. As a member of Green America’s Green Business Network ( www.greenbusinessnetwork.org ), GalaxyVisions is implementing many initiatives to conserve energy in order to provide more eco-friendly solutions. The company uses high powered exhaust fans and filtration systems to take advantage of the cold outside air throughout the winter months as its primary cooling system.

IT pros still spooked by Office’s ribbon interface

IT pros still spooked by Office’s ribbon interface Four years after its debut, the “ribbon” interface in Microsoft’s Office suite still gives businesses the shudders, a research firm said today. The interface first appeared in Office 2007 to catcalls as users struggled with the massive redesign, which substituted a wide ribbon-like display at the top for the traditional drop-down menus, small icons and toolbars that epitomized Windows applications’ look-and-feel for decades.

Google Could Drive Mobile Two-Factor Authentication Model

Google Could Drive Mobile Two-Factor Authentication Model Google’s announcement this week that it will offer two-factor authentication for Google Apps is an encouraging sign for the state of multifactor authentication in the cloud — particularly using the mobile form factor, which some believe could overcome some of the challenges that have plagued multifactor deployments in the past. The search engine giant’s new two-factor approach sends a verification code via SMS message or mobile app to augment the traditional username and password sign-in.
